City kicks off reading program
The second season of the City of Toledo summer reading program, sponsored by the city's Youth Commission, has begun at five city parks.
The free program for children ages 5 to 12, takes place from 9 a.m. to 1 p.m. Mondays through Thursdays through July 31 at Gunckel Park, 740 Collingwood Blvd.; Jamie Farr Park, 2140 Summit St.; the Rev. H.V. Savage Park, Vance Street and City Park Avenue; Smith Park, 910 Dorr St.; and Walbridge Park, 2801 Broadway.
Children who take part in the reading program will receive a snack during the day.
